Where Does Vital Products, Inc.’ Stand in the Current Market?

The company, specializing in custom thermoformed packaging, maintains a strong market position. While specific market share details aren't publicly available, it's recognized as a key player in providing high-precision packaging solutions. This positions the company well within a growing sector.

The global thermoformed packaging market was valued at approximately $45.2 billion in 2024. Projections estimate this market to exceed $60 billion by 2029, indicating a favorable growth environment for specialists like the company. The company's focus on high-value, complex packaging challenges allows it to maintain a premium market position.

The company's primary product lines include custom thermoformed trays and clamshells, designed to meet stringent industry-specific requirements. The company primarily serves the medical, electronics, and consumer goods sectors, where the demand for protective, customized, and often sterile packaging is paramount. The company's sustained growth and investment in advanced manufacturing technologies suggest a robust financial standing, particularly in providing packaging for medical devices and sensitive electronic components.

Who Are the Main Competitors Challenging Vital Products, Inc.?

The competitive landscape for Vital Products, Inc. is shaped by a mix of direct and indirect competitors within the packaging industry. The company faces competition from both large, diversified packaging corporations and smaller, specialized thermoforming businesses. Direct Competitors

Direct competitors offer similar products and services in the thermoforming market. These companies often compete on design, manufacturing capabilities, and geographic reach. Key players include Dordan Manufacturing, Prent Corporation, and specialized divisions of Sonoco Products Company.

Icon

Dordan Manufacturing

Dordan Manufacturing is a custom thermoformer known for design and manufacturing across medical, electronics, and consumer markets. They compete with Vital Products, Inc. on design innovation and rapid prototyping. In 2024, Dordan's revenue was estimated at approximately $50 million, reflecting its strong position in custom thermoforming.

Icon

Prent Corporation

Prent Corporation is a global player specializing in precision thermoformed packaging for medical and electronics industries. They often compete on scale and global reach. Prent's global revenue in 2024 was estimated to be around $400 million, indicating their significant market presence.

Icon

Sonoco Products Company

Sonoco Products Company has specialized thermoforming divisions that compete for larger contracts. They leverage material science expertise and extensive distribution networks. Sonoco's packaging segment generated approximately $4.5 billion in revenue in 2024, showcasing their broad market influence.

Indirect Competitors

Indirect competitors offer alternative packaging solutions. These include companies using injection molding, blow molding, or paper-based packaging. The rise of sustainable packaging also presents a challenge. This segment is expected to grow, with a projected market value of $280 billion by 2025.

Icon

Emerging Players

Emerging players focus on sustainable and biodegradable packaging materials. The sustainable packaging market is growing rapidly. The market is projected to reach $400 billion by 2027, highlighting the importance of eco-friendly options.

Icon

Competitive Dynamics

The packaging industry experiences frequent mergers and acquisitions, impacting the competitive landscape. These consolidations create larger, more integrated competitors. Understanding these shifts is critical for Vital Products, Inc.'s market analysis and strategic planning.

  • Mergers and Acquisitions: Recent activity includes acquisitions of specialized thermoformers by larger packaging firms. For example, a major acquisition in 2024 could significantly alter the competitive balance.
  • Material Innovations: Developments in materials science, such as the adoption of bio-based plastics, influence product offerings and market positioning.
  • Sustainability Trends: Growing demand for eco-friendly packaging drives innovation and competition in sustainable solutions. The sustainable packaging market is expected to grow by 10% annually through 2026.
  • Geographic Expansion: Companies are expanding their global presence to serve international markets, increasing the need for efficient supply chains and local market knowledge.

What Gives Vital Products, Inc. a Competitive Edge Over Its Rivals?

Analyzing the competitive landscape, Vital Products, Inc. (VPI) distinguishes itself through several core competitive advantages. These advantages are primarily rooted in its specialized expertise, proprietary design capabilities, and unwavering commitment to quality. This positions VPI favorably within the protective packaging market, especially in sectors demanding high precision and reliability. Understanding these strengths is crucial for a comprehensive company analysis.

VPI's ability to offer highly customized thermoforming solutions is a key differentiator, particularly in regulated industries like medical and electronics. The company's proprietary design processes and tooling expertise enable the creation of intricate packaging tailored to unique product specifications. This includes complex geometries and material requirements, supported by advanced CAD/CAM systems and rapid prototyping, which significantly reduces lead times. This focus on innovation and customization is a cornerstone of VPI's business strategy.

Brand equity and customer loyalty are also significant assets for VPI. Over nearly 40 years of operation, the company has cultivated a strong reputation for reliability, consistency, and exceptional customer service. This has fostered long-term relationships with clients who value VPI's problem-solving approach. This is a crucial element when assessing Vital Products Inc.'s competitive position.

Icon Industry Trends

Technological advancements, particularly in automation and smart manufacturing (Industry 4.0), are boosting production efficiency and precision in thermoforming. Regulatory changes, especially in the medical device and pharmaceutical packaging sectors, are increasing the need for traceability and material compliance. Consumer demand is shifting towards sustainable and eco-friendly packaging solutions.

Icon Future Challenges

Potential disruptions include new market entrants offering specialized sustainable solutions or larger players acquiring smaller innovators. A rapid decline in demand for traditional plastic packaging due to environmental concerns poses a risk. Aggressive pricing strategies from competitors in less regulated sectors could also impact Vital Products, Inc.

Icon Opportunities

Significant growth opportunities exist in emerging markets, particularly in Asia and Latin America, where industrialization and healthcare infrastructure development are driving demand. Product innovations, such as active and intelligent packaging, also represent a substantial growth avenue. Strategic partnerships with material science companies can foster innovation.

Icon Strategic Response

Strategies should focus on continuous innovation in sustainable materials, enhancing automation capabilities, and expanding geographic reach.
